# NOTE for future maintainers:
# This batch_size setting exists because of the old N+1 mess in the
# Fernwick GraphQL API — resolvers used to fire one query per node.
# The loader now batches at 50. Don't lower it without load-testing.
# Batching stats are logged to the metrics DB, reachable at the
# connection string below.

replica DSN, yahaf-yagaf: mongodb://tamath_svc:a2netSk3RZMuTj@db-d084.novacsoft.internal:5432/ralmir

- [ ] Step 7: Archive cold storage buckets (Glacierline tier). Confirm both ceremony witnesses are present, verify bucket manifests match the Oxbow ledger, then seal the archive key shares. Plugin authors may observe but not handle shares. Once sealed, the archive index itself is encrypted and can only be reopened with the passphrase below.

vault phrase of badup-hahig = tamael-aldael-kelmir-istael-fenok-istwyn-tamius-jorath-oliion

For the release manager: during the 4.2 verification pass we found that the DeltaScope production pods no longer match the checked-in baseline. Chunking thresholds, memory-map limits, and the syntax-highlight cutoff for files over the large-file boundary have all drifted, apparently from manual hotfixes applied during the Quarrow incident. Diff rendering times vary between pods as a result. We should reconcile before cutting the release candidate. The current live configuration values, captured today, are reproduced below.

deployment values, hahip-kajep:
HOLAX_PIN=4003
HOLAX_METRICS_HOST=metrics.holax.zemvarworks.internal
HOLAX_LOG_LEVEL=warn
HOLAX_TENANT=fraael

Each turnstile at Gatewick Arena emits a pulse per rotation; the counter service debounces pulses, aggregates per-gate counts, and publishes occupancy every few seconds. Double-counting from bounce and undercounting from tailgating are corrected with a calibration factor derived from steward spot checks. Reviewer: the debounce window, aggregation interval, and calibration bounds are deliberately conservative for the season opener and will be revisited after two home matches. The current tuning constants are as follows.

constants for tageg-kagag:
QUOTAS = {
    "kelax": 495,
    "istath": 366,
    "tammir": 108,
    "novdor": 730,
    "casax": 816,
    "quenael": 874,
    "pelius": 403,
}